During the Rally Hungary, the HUMDA Zöld Életre Valók roadshow visits Veszprém
The complex e-mobility roadshow of HUMDA Magyar Mobility Development Agency Zrt., which belongs to the Széchenyi University Group, Green for Life, will visit Veszprém between April 12 and 14 during the Rally Hungary, the agency told MTI.
The purpose of the roadshow is to make sustainable and environmentally friendly energy a part of everyday life and to promote the green transition, since green energy is the future of the Hungarian economy in households, transport and industry.
It has been announced: in the service parks of the Rally Hungary competition and in front of the Veszprém Arena, the organizers are waiting for interested people from kindergarten to the elderly from Friday to Sunday. The mission of the national e-mobility and technology roadshow of HUMDA Zöld Élétre Valók is to spread knowledge about hydrogen technology, energy storage and electric vehicles, their advantages, operation and environmental aspects. On the country tour, the general public can encounter public installations and free activities.
